About This Novel

Comrade Liu Bei unfortunately passed away on the way to help the Han Dynasty. As a stinky Bingzhou Xiongnu who was discriminated against, Liu Yuan wanted to just lie down and become a comfortable foreign minister like Jin Rixi during the period of Emperor Wu of the Han Dynasty. It was originally thought that Sima Yan, Emperor Wu of Jin, would activate the innate love ability that every founding emperor had. However, the Hu-Han problem that had survived from the founding of the Eastern Han Dynasty became increasingly serious, and Sima Yan was unable to do anything. For the sake of political correctness, and also to prevent the tragedy of Wu Huan's chaos from happening again. Liu Yuan gritted his teeth, turned around, and shouted to the barbarians and lower-class people behind him who were discriminated against and despised by the aristocratic families, and shouted the words engraved in the history books: "Forget the front, forget the middle, in short, prosper the Han Dynasty!"
